Before beginning the game I decided that my strategy would be to alternate between routes every two times, beginning with route c. It seemed to work for the first 5 days or so, but soon the other driver took the shortcut many more times in a row than I did which led to us meeting halfway various times and them taking the shortcut more times amounting to $900 for them and 420$ for me. For the second time around, I decided to use the same strategy and it seemed to work pretty efficiently as we never crossed paths except for the two times I decided to lower the gate. I earned $960 while O earned $1140. I used the longer path more times than the other driver did. After doing both of these games I learned that it is difficult to generate decisions to benefit both players when there is no communication as one wants to minimize their loses, but also help the other in order to maximize wins.
